IBM to Offer Lotus Symphony Free

Posted on September 18, 2007

IBM has announced the launch of free Lotus Symphony to compete with  Microsoft Office  and Google Docs & Sheet (who has added its final product Presently in the Suite).

According to New York Times, IBM Lotus Symphony includes word processing, spreadsheets and presentations which will be available as free downloadable from IBM website.
